Bernard Blackburn
Bernard P. Blackburn, 80, of Mondovi, Wis., formerly of Anoka, died Nov. 9, 2002 at his home after a lengthy illness.
He was born Jan. 27, 1922 in Cresco, Iowa, to Patrick and Regina Blackburn and was a U.S. Marine veteran serving in the South Pacific. He owned and operated the Blackburn-Horejs Funeral Home in Anoka for many years before becoming a counselor for the chemically dependent and their families and moving to Eau Claire, Wis., in 1970.
He is survived by his wife, Randee; first wife, Georgya; children, Susan, Sean, Steven, Sarah, Samuel, Sandra, Scott, Seth and Stanford; 12 grandchildren; two-great-grandchildren; brother, John; six nieces; four grand-nephews; and four great-nieces.
He was preceded in death by his parents; and brothers, Lowell and Gerald.
Arrangements were by the Cremation Society of Wisconsin, Eau Claire, and Prock Funeral Home.

Agnes Melin
Funeral services for Agnes Melin, 100, Coon Rapids, formerly of Ogema, took place Oct. 30 at Lund Lutheran Church, Detroit Lakes. Rev. John Lee officiated.
Melin died Oct. 26, 2002 at Park River Estates Care Center, Coon Rapids. She was born Sept. 3, 1902 in Motala, Sweden, to August and Selma Karlsson. She came to the United States with her parents in 1919.
She is survived by her son, Edwin (Marvel) Melin and their children Jeff (Peggi) of Coon Rapids, Ron (Shari) of Anoka, Don (Leah) of East Bethel, and Debbie (Dan) Jaakola of Spring Lake Park; three stepsons; two stepdaughters; many grandchildren, great-grandchildren, and great-great grandchildren; and nieces and nephews.
She was preceded in death by her husband, Carl; parents; five brothers; two sisters; and a grandson.
Pallbearers were Jeffrey, Ronald, Donald, Rodney, Bruce and Danial Melin.
Interment was at Lund Lutheran Church cemetery. Arrangements were by West-Kjos Funeral Home, Detroit Lakes.
